MARC details
000 -LEADER |
campo de control de longitud fija |
03163nam a22003857a 4500 |
003 - IDENTIFICADOR DE NÚMERO DE CONTROL |
campo de control |
BO-EaUP |
005 - FECHA Y HORA DE LA ÚLTIMA TRANSACCIÓN |
campo de control |
20240909151536.0 |
008 - DATOS DE LONGITUD FIJA--INFORMACIÓN GENERAL |
campo de control de longitud fija |
240724b |||||||| |||| 00| 0 eng d |
015 ## - NÚMERO DE BIBLIOGRAFÍA NACIONAL |
Número de bibliografía nacional |
2007 |
Información calificativa |
M.22.273-2007 |
020 ## - NÚMERO INTERNACIONAL ESTÁNDAR DEL LIBRO |
Número Internacional Estándar del Libro |
978-84-481-5656-5 |
040 ## - FUENTE DE CATALOGACIÓN |
Centro catalogador/agencia de origen |
Biblioteca de Ingenieria de Sistemas |
Lengua de catalogación |
spa |
Centro/agencia transcriptor |
Biblioteca de Ingenieria de Sistemas |
Normas de descripción |
RDA |
041 ## - CÓDIGO DE IDIOMA |
Código de lengua del texto/banda sonora o título independiente |
spa |
Código de lengua original |
Ingles |
043 ## - CÓDIGO DE ÁREA GEOGRÁFICA |
Código de área geográfica |
e-sp |
082 ## - NÚMERO DE LA CLASIFICACIÓN DECIMAL DEWEY |
Número de edición |
21 |
Número de clasificación |
005.42 |
092 ## - ASIGNACIÓN LOCAL DE SIGNATURA TOPOGRÁFICA DEWEY (OCLC) |
Número de clasificación |
005.42 |
Signatura Librística |
D611 |
100 ## - ENTRADA PRINCIPAL--NOMBRE DE PERSONA |
Nombre de persona |
Grune |
Títulos y otros términos asociados al nombre |
Doctor |
Término indicativo de función/relación |
Autor |
9 (RLIN) |
3609 |
242 ## - TÍTULO TRADUCIDO POR EL CENTRO/AGENCIA CATALOGADOR |
Título |
Modern Compiler Design |
245 ## - MENCIÓN DEL TÍTULO |
Título |
Diseño de compiladores modernos / |
Mención de responsabilidad, etc. |
Dick Grune |
250 ## - MENCION DE EDICION |
Mención de edición |
Primera Edición |
260 ## - PUBLICACIÓN, DISTRIBUCIÓN, ETC. |
Lugar de publicación, distribución, etc. |
España : |
Nombre del editor, distribuidor, etc. |
McGraw-Hill, |
Fecha de publicación, distribución, etc. |
31/05/2007 |
300 ## - DESCRIPCIÓN FÍSICA |
Extensión |
xix, 682 páginas ; |
Otras características físicas |
Ilustraciones (blanco y negro), figuras, diagramas ; tapa blanda ; |
Dimensiones |
25x19.5 centímetros ; |
Tipo de unidad |
rústico |
336 ## - TIPO DE CONTENIDO |
Fuente |
rdacontenido |
Término de tipo de contenido |
texto |
Código de tipo de contenido |
txt |
337 ## - TIPO DE MEDIO |
Fuente |
rdamedia |
Nombre/término del tipo de medio |
no mediado |
Código del tipo de medio |
n |
338 ## - TIPO DE SOPORTE |
Nombre/término del tipo de soporte |
volumen |
Código del tipo de soporte |
nc |
505 ## - NOTA DE CONTENIDO CON FORMATO |
Nota de contenido con formato |
Titulo en lenguaje ingles: Modern Compiler Design |
520 ## - RESUMEN, ETC. |
Sumario, etc. |
1. Introducción.-- 2. Del texto de programa al árbol sintáctico abstracto.-- 3. Anotación del AST - el contexto.-- 4. Procesado del código intermedio.-- 5. Gestión de memoria.-- 6. Programas imperativos y programas orientados a objetos.-- 7. Programas funcionales.-- 8. Programas Lógicos.-- 9. Programas paralelos y distribuidos.-- Apéndice A: Un compilador/interprete orientado a objetos. |
520 ## - RESUMEN, ETC. |
Sumario, etc. |
Un compilador es una de las partes más vitales del software de un ordenador, puesto que traduce programas escritos en un lenguaje de alto nivel a comandos de bajo nivel que la máquina puede entender y ejecutar. La mayoría de los libros de diseño de compiladores se enfocan sólo en las técnicas para lenguajes imperativos (o procedimentales) como C o Pascal, mientras que Diseño de compiladores modernos también trata de técnicas de compilación para lenguajes orientados a objetos, funcionales, lógicos y distribuidos. Se pone el énfasis práctico en las técnicas de implementación y optimización, que incluyen herramientas para el diseño automático de compiladores. Las características del libro incluyen: ¿ Enfoque en técnicas avanzadas y tradicionales básicas comunes a todos los paradigmas de los lenguajes, que proporcionan a los lectores las habilidades necesarias para la construcción de compiladores modernos. ¿ Tratamiento de todos los tipos de lenguajes de programación más importantes: imperativos, orientados a objetos, funcionales, lógicos y distribuidos. ¿ Un fuerte e intuitivo estilo, ilustrado con muchos ejemplos prácticos. Además, todos los autores son profesores e investigadores de lenguajes de programación y de su implementación además de tener mucha experiencia en la construcción de compiladores para muchos lenguajes. |
521 ## - NOTA DE PÚBLICO DESTINATARIO |
Nota de público destinatario |
Esta destinado a docentes y estudiantes de carreras de ingeniería, ciencias tecnológicas. |
650 ## - PUNTO DE ACCESO ADICIONAL DE MATERIA--TÉRMINO DE MATERIA |
Término de materia o nombre geográfico como elemento de entrada |
SISTEMAS OPERATIVOS |
9 (RLIN) |
3610 |
700 ## - ENTRADA AGREGADA--NOMBRE PERSONAL |
Nombre de persona |
Henri e. Bal |
Término indicativo de función/relación |
Autor |
9 (RLIN) |
3612 |
700 ## - ENTRADA AGREGADA--NOMBRE PERSONAL |
Nombre de persona |
Ceril J. H. Jacobs |
Término indicativo de función/relación |
Autor |
9 (RLIN) |
4764 |
700 ## - ENTRADA AGREGADA--NOMBRE PERSONAL |
Nombre de persona |
Koen G. Langendoen |
Término indicativo de función/relación |
Autor |
9 (RLIN) |
4765 |
700 ## - ENTRADA AGREGADA--NOMBRE PERSONAL |
Nombre de persona |
Alfredo Catalina Gallego |
Término indicativo de función/relación |
Traductor |
9 (RLIN) |
4766 |
942 ## - ELEMENTOS DE ENTRADA SECUNDARIOS (KOHA) |
Fuente del sistema de clasificación o colocación |
Clasificación Decimal Dewey |
Tipo de ítem Koha |
Libros |
Edición |
21 |
Suprimir en OPAC |
No |